Part of 826CHI’s mission is to help teachers inspire their students to write. To accomplish this we have several resources for educators:

placeholder

“I have never seen a group of students so proud of themselves and so excited about work they’d produced in the classroom.”

– Teacher Leslie Locket after an
In-schools project

Field Trips

Bring your classroom to our space for a morning of high-energy writing fun!

In-Schools

We bring our tutors to your classroom.

Publishing

We publish your students' words.

Teacher events and trainings

826CHI offers workshops for CPDU credits and other teacher-specific events.
